Negotiated rates by payer
?

Negotiated rate

The price a specific insurance plan agreed to pay the hospital for a service — it varies by insurer, and even by plan within the same insurer.

Example: The same knee MRI has a negotiated rate of $904 with one insurer's PPO plan and $1,509 with another's — identical hospital, identical scan.

Plan
?

Plan

The specific product an insurer sells — e.g. "Blue Cross PPO 500" — which sets your deductible, coinsurance and negotiated rates.

Example: Two people both insured by Aetna can owe very different amounts for the same MRI: $50 with an HMO plan's flat copay, or the full $1,200 toward a high-deductible PPO plan's unmet deductible.
